Responsibilities

  • Support end-to-end fulfillment of contingent staffing requirements through Target’s approved vendor network
  • Source, screen, and coordinate interviews for contract resources in alignment with business needs
  • Facilitate onboarding of contractors by ensuring completion of all required documentation and compliance steps
  • Track and report fulfillment status to stakeholders
  • Follow and uphold standardized contingent staffing processes and policies
  • Maintain accurate documentation for all stages of the contracting lifecycle
  • Support process improvement initiatives by identifying and escalating operational challenges
  • Ensure adherence to defined service levels and turnaround times
  • Work closely with project managers, service line leaders, and vendor partners to align on hiring priorities
  • Demonstrate strong communication and collaboration across internal and external stakeholders
  • Promote teamwork and maintain transparency throughout the staffing cycle
  • Liaise with vendor partners for day-to-day coordination of staffing requests and issue resolution
  • Support vendor performance tracking and provide input into periodic performance reviews
  • Escalate partner-related issues to the Senior Procurement Ops Professional as needed
  • Ensure partner and contractor compliance with Target’s policies and legal/statutory requirements
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records in the agreement and contractor repository
  • Support invoice validation and tracking of contractor payments and accruals
  • Follow documentation standards and confidentiality guidelines consistently

About Target

Target Corporation is a retail company that offers a wide range of products, including clothing, electronics, home goods, and groceries, through nearly 2,000 stores and an online platform. Its "Design For All" philosophy allows it to provide high-quality, affordable products that cater to diverse customer needs. Target differentiates itself from competitors with its owned brands and the Target Circle loyalty program, which enhances customer engagement. The company's goal is to support sustainability and community initiatives by giving back 5% of its profits to local communities.
